Continue ReadingNorthern Kentucky played host to KBC’s The Journey this past weekend and there were plenty of high level games over the course of 2 days. Here’s a look at some of the top performers of the weekend in the 16u division.
Jacob Meyer Jacob Meyer 6'2" | PG Holy Cross Covington | 2023 #170 Nation GA , Midwest Basketball Club – The Champions of the tournament are an Ohio program but Meyer is one of their best players. Hard to keep out of the paint, Jacob is able to get downhill and either finish or kick to open teammates. Midwest hit a lot of wide open threes over the weekend and many were thanks to the penetration of the Holy Cross guard.
Zee McCown Zee McCown 5'10" | PG Pleasure Ridge Park | 2023 State PA , Quinn Anvils – The heady guard from PRP was one of the stars of the weekend. It seemed like he couldn’t miss on Sunday whether it was from 30 feet or 3 feet away. McCown plays on or off the ball and is one of the best guards in Louisville.
Ondre Wicks Ondre Wicks 6'5" | SF Western | 2023 State KY , Griffin Elite Rogers – Wicks does a little bit of everything. He scores around the basket or can drive it and is capable of making catch and shoot threes. He rebounds at a high rate and protects the rim as an above average shot blocker. He’s a player to watch in the 6th region these next 2 years.
Jaden Biggers Jaden Biggers 6'6" | PF Bryan Station | 2023 State KY , Griffin Elite Bordas – Bordas’ team had their weekend cut short when they lost to Qunn Anvils but the big man from Bryan Station led their team in nearly every statistical category for the weekend. Jaden has polished post skills and will be looking for a big Junior season under a new coach for the Defenders.
Eian Elmer Eian Elmer 6'6" | SF Taft | 2023 State OH , Queen City Prophets – One of the better 2023s that no one seems to know about, Elmer is super athletic with a good feel for the game. Eian has great position size as a big wing and can attack the rim off the catch. His shot mechanics are a little slow but he can make jumpers with range.
Marcus Eaves Marcus Eaves 6'4" | SF North Hopkins | 2023 State KY , Up Next – Up Next had a short stay for the weekend, finishing at 1-2 on the weekend but Eaves showed he can compete amongst the best in the 23 class as he was able to score the ball all weekend as well as rebound at a high level. He’s play out of position with Up Next but he’s a solid wing prospect to track for the next 2 years.
Cam Brogan Cam Brogan 5'10" | PG Bullitt East | 2023 State KY , Louisville Prospects – Cam is an old fashioned floor general who knows how to run a team. Brogan took care of the ball all weekend and avoided pressure with a quick handle and above average passing. He’s not super aggressive as a scorer but he can score the ball when needed.
Kenyon Goodin Kenyon Goodin 6'3" | CG Collins | 2023 State KY , Manimal Elite – Goodin has clearly bulked up his frame and that allows him to finish through contact even better than he has before. Kenyon led Manimal in scoring for every game of the Silver bracket, which they eventually won.
